JOBURG - It's official, J Cole, the most soulful rapper on the scene at the moment, will be making his way to South Africa to perform for the second time.
![](https://images.caxton.co.za/wp-content/uploads/sites/23/2016/03/rac13JCole_74856.jpg)
J Cole’s South African fans are reeling since the announcement was made that SAB and Castle will be bringing the famous rapper to South Africa on 18 June.
What’s got his fans’ heads spinning?
He will be performing in a one-night-only show at the TicketPro Dome in Johannesburg, leaving his fans in the other provinces out in the ‘Cole World’.

Tickets went on sale on 31 March – at a significantly lower cost than the likes of Rihanna and Justin Bieber – and they’re selling out fast.
